This from "Peter Smith of Jamaica, Long Island, and some of his Descendants"
contributed by Samuel Stelle Smith. 1954
Peter6 SMITH was born Dec. 4, 1794, in Piscataway, NJ and died there Dec. 2,
1853. He lived in the old family homestead on Raritan Landing Road, having
inherited one half of the property from his father, Oct. 30, 1817. Peter was
active in the civic life of the community and took a prominent part in the
affairs of the First Baptist Church of Piscataway, serving as Deacon from
1839 until his death. On Aug. 31, 1820, he married Sarah STELLE who was born
in 1802 and died Apr. 20, 1890, in Piscataway, a daughter of David STELLE and
his wife Rachel RUNYON. Through her paternal grandmother, Sarah DUNHAM, Sarah
was a descendant of the Mayflower passenger, Edward FULLER.
